Key Responsibilities
- Plan and undertake comprehensive occupational hygiene exposure assessments.
- Conduct personal and static monitoring for airborne contaminants and physical hazards.
- Assess workplace exposure to contaminants including: Respirable crystalline silica, Welding fumes, Wood dust, Metals, Solvents, Gases, Other hazardous workplace contaminants
- Undertake noise, heat stress, ventilation and respiratory protection assessments.
- Develop appropriate Similar Exposure Groups (SEGs) and defensible sampling strategies.
- Communicate technical findings clearly to workers, managers and senior leadership.
- Support clients with ongoing health-risk management programmes and monitoring strategies.
